不是我所知,不。所有ODBC和OLE-DB驱动程序二进制注册都由系统范围的控件处理。 ODBC确实允许每用户连接设置,它仍然需要系统范围的二进制安装。如果你正在编写一个“便携式”(免安装)应用程序,我推荐使用Sqlite。
顺便说一下,今天使用JET Red(MS Access)而不是像Sqlite这样积极开发的系统考虑工具的限制,以及SQL实现是如何非标准的(例如它不支持)的原因很少 COALESCE 并且它还需要围绕每个的括号对 JOIN )。
COALESCE
JOIN